Executive summary

  • Revenue declined 27% year-over-year to €43.08 million in H1 2024, driven by weak demand and significant logistics disruptions, especially in Q2 due to a transition to a new logistics provider.

  • EBIT loss deepened by 81% to €-21.78 million, and net loss after tax increased 55% to €-24.98 million compared to H1 2023.

  • A comprehensive restructuring plan is underway, focusing on supply chain overhaul, inventory optimization, and cost reduction.

  • Leadership changes include the appointment of a new CEO and a new Group Director HR to drive transformation.

Financial highlights

  • Revenue: €43.08 million (down 27% year-over-year).

  • EBIT: €-21.78 million (down 81% year-over-year).

  • Net loss after tax: €-24.98 million (up 55% year-over-year).

  • Earnings per share: €-2.61 (vs. €-1.68 in H1 2023).

  • Free cash flow improved to €-4.13 million from €-11.11 million in H1 2023.

  • Cash and cash equivalents at period end: €2.53 million.

Outlook and guidance

  • The company expects continued macroeconomic headwinds and is focused on reconnecting with core customers through product innovation and operational improvements.

  • Cost-saving measures and operational streamlining are expected to yield sustainable benefits into 2025.

  • Lanvin Group Holdings has issued a comfort letter guaranteeing financial support through July 2026.
